Comments (7)The room has exquisite bones: the windows, flooring and decorative crown molding. If simplicity is what you want but with a bit more personal taste, I suggest the following: 1) paint the walls white that has a soft, warm undertone such as Benjamin and Moore's moonlight white or Dove. (Or try any good paint store for help on picking the right white color.) Paint the molding a stark white with an egg shell or gloss finish. 2) keep the bed covering as is. I love the warm colors and mixed patterns. If you do want more comfort, yes add a thicker mattress. Can you get a fabric similar for the table top? Or just remove the fabric from the table top, painting or stenciling it with a similar pattern. (see #5 below for where to look for stencils.) 3) Move the table to the head of the bed, add a modern lamp and lots of books or other meaningful, personal items. 4) Add a comfy chair or as suggested above, pile lush floor pillows where the table is, under the window. Use complementing or solid color fabric on the floor pillows or chair. Add a small table with more lighting. (See my most popular post on Floor Pillows. Towards the end you will see examples of suitable floor pillows. Or just do a search here on Houzz and the internet.) 5) Make a dramatic statement above the bed with a very large painting. Select with care based upon your personal taste: abstract, minimal but with a hint or some of the colors found in the bedding fabric. It doesn't have to be centered, a little off centered will do since there appears to already be something on the wall above the bed. Do add a soft art lamp above the painting. (If you don't have money for the painting, purchase a very large canvas, take your time and create it yourself (collage it, play around with paint on paper before adding it to your canvas, stencil it, etc.--but have fun and make it personal) Here's a great place for getting a wide range of designs for stenciling: Cutting Edge Stencils. Note you don't have to take the design all the way to the edge of the canvas! 6) Add a small (wool) flokati rug in front of the bed. Get the kind that comes from Greece, it has long-fibers and a plush pile. These rugs are to die for when it comes to comfort and texture--and they're inexpensive. Take a look and if you like it, be sure to get wool: Flokati Rug.Net. These ideas will give you lots of varying textures to get rid of the boredom; contrasting colors for depth and drama; play up the wonderful architectural elements already found in the room; personalize it with what you love; and still, keep it simple and beautiful.
